Description

Une vulnérabilité dans le traitement des lignes de commandes (CLI) permet à un utilisateur local mal intentionné d'élever ses privilèges pour devenir administrateur du système.

Solution

Se référer au bulletin de sécurité de l'éditeur pour l'obtention des correctifs (cf. section Documentation).

Cisco Intrusion Prevention System (IPS) 5.x.
